Technology – Data and Decision Science – Data Engineering – Senior
The Opportunity In this role, you will design and build analytics solutions that deliver significant business value. You will collaborate with other data and analytics professionals, management, and stakeholders to ensure that technical requirements align with business needs. Your responsibilities include creating scalable data architecture and modeling solutions that support the entire data asset lifecycle.
Your Key Responsibilities
Designing, building, and operating scalable on‑premises or cloud data architecture.
Analyzing business requirements and translating them into technical specifications.
Optimizing data flows for target data platform designs.
Design, develop, and implement data engineering solutions using Databricks on c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, Azure, GCP).
Collaborate with clients to understand their data needs and provide tailored solutions that meet their business objectives.
Lead end‑to‑end data pipeline development, including data ingestion, transformation, and storage.
Ensure data quality, integrity, and security throughout the data lifecycle.
Provide technical guidance and mentorship to junior data engineers and team members.
Communicate effectively with stakeholders, including technical and non‑technical audiences, to convey complex data concepts.
Manage client relationships and expectations, ensuring high levels of satisfaction and engagement.
Stay updated with the latest trends and technologies in data engineering and cloud computing.
Skills And Attributes For Success
Strong analytical and decision‑making skills.
Proficiency in cloud computing and data architecture design.
Experience in data integration and security.
Ability to manage complex problem‑solving scenarios.
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field (4‑year degree); Master’s degree preferred.
Minimum 5 years of experience in data engineering, focusing on cloud data solutions, with at least two end‑to‑end data engineering implementations (including data lake and real‑time pipelines using Databricks).
Expertise in Databricks and experience with Spark for big data processing.
Strong programming skills in Python, Scala, or SQL.
Experience with data modeling, ETL processes, and data warehousing concepts.
Excellent problem‑solving skills and 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with a focus on client management.
Required Expertise for Senior Consulting Projects
Strategic thinking – align data engineering solutions with business strategies and objectives.
Project management – manage multiple projects simultaneously, ensuring timely delivery and adherence to scope.
Stakeholder engagement – engage executives and other stakeholders, presenting solutions effectively.
Change management – guide clients through change processes related to data transformation and technology adoption.
Risk management – identify potential risks in data projects and develop mitigation strategies.
Technical leadership – lead technical discussions and make architectural decisions.
Documentation and reporting – create comprehensive documentation and reports to communicate project progress to clients.
Ideally, You’ll also have
Experience with data quality management.
Familiarity with semantic layers in data architecture.
Familiarity with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and their data services.
Knowledge of data governance and compliance standards.
Experience with machine learning frameworks and tools.

Competitive compensation and benefits package, with base salary ranging in the US between $106,900 and $176,500 (varies by location).
Comprehensive medical, dental, vision, pension and 401(k) plans along with paid time off.
Flexible vacation policy that allows you to decide your own vacation time, plus paid holidays, winter/summer breaks, personal/family care and other leaves.
Hybrid work model – 40–60% in‑person for client‑serving roles.
